Mortal Kombat: Shaolin Monks Review

If you are a fan of the Mortal Kombat franchise then get ready for its newest installment, Mortal Kombat: Shaolin Monks. This game features some of your favorite themes of the Mortal Kombat series, but with a new twist!

Shaolin Monks is much different from previous Mortal Kombat games because you can now play cooperatively with another player. This is the first time that you have ever been able to do this in any of the Mortal Kombat games! You can play as either Liu Kang or Kung Lao, together or alone. The game takes place directly after the ending of Mortal Kombat 1. You get to see the game from the viewpoint of the two Shaolin Monks and take them through the famous Mortal Kombat tournament and Oddworld. The entire cast returns for epic battles and fatalities!

This game features a new character customization option. You can now spend earned experience points to further develop your player. Learn new abilities such as: running along walls, agility, or special attacks. Another new element is that each character has 10 fatalities, each with 3 levels. At level 2, you learn Multality. This enables you to kill multiple enemies at once. At level 3 you learn Brutalities. This is a vicious attack that allows you to clear an entire room!

In this game you can expect to use your environment to aid you in taking out your foes. Classic mechanisms of doing so are still available, along with some new ones. Toss your foe in a pit of acid, impale him on a spiked wall, or throw him against living trees. Classic attacks are available along with the new Mutality and Brutalities. You may also find weapons to aid you as you progress through the game.

Mortal Combat: Shaolin Monks has various secrets and characters to unlock. This is a much welcomed surprise. Many secrets about Mortal Kombat can be unlocked and revealed to you. One secret is how Subzero got the scar on his face...

The combat system is flawless and the controls are smooth with fluid character movement. The texture of the game and its backgrounds are lovely. However, the character models are a bit rough. The voice acting is not so great, but the musical score is outstanding. It really gets you moving!

Mortla Kombat: Shaolin Monks is available for Playstation 2. It has an ESRB rating of M for Mature. This is because it contains gore, blood, and intense violence. A strategy guide is available for those of you that need a few cheats.
